Mathematica文本数据导入导出技巧分享
在数据分析中,我们经常需要从不同的数据来源导入数据进行处理。Mathematica是一款支持多种数据格式的工具,下面分享一些关于文本数据导入导出的经验与技巧。生成随机数据首先,让我们生成一些随机的数据
在数据分析中,我们经常需要从不同的数据来源导入数据进行处理。Mathematica是一款支持多种数据格式的工具,下面分享一些关于文本数据导入导出的经验与技巧。
生成随机数据
首先,让我们生成一些随机的数据,并设定一个随机的种子以便于调试。代码如下:
```
SeedRandom[123];
data RandomInteger[{0, 10}, {5, 3}];
Export["data.txt", data, "Table"]
```
上述代码将在当前目录下生成一个名为"data.txt"的文本文件,其中包含了我们生成的随机数据。通过这个例子,我们可以学习到如何使用`Export`函数将数据导出到文本文件中。
导入文本数据
接下来,让我们看看如何将文本数据导入到Mathematica中。代码如下:
```
importedData Import["data.txt"]
```
使用`Import`函数可以将指定的文本文件导入到Mathematica中。运行上述代码后,我们可以使用`Head`函数查看导入后的数据类型:
```
Head[importedData]
```
输出结果为`String`。由此可见,导入的数据类型并不是我们期望的整数类型。因此,在导入文本数据时,我们需要注意数据类型的转换问题。
指定导入格式
为了解决上述问题,我们需要指定导入的数据格式。代码如下:
```
importedData Import["data.txt", "Table"]
```
这里我们将导入格式指定为`Table`,即表格格式。这样,导入的数据就会自动转换为Mathematica能够识别的整数类型。
导入表格数据
最后,让我们来看看如何导入表格数据。代码如下:
```
tableData Import["table.xls", {"Data", 1}]
```
使用`Import`函数加载表格数据时,我们需要指定数据源和数据位置。在上述代码中,我们使用了Excel文件作为数据源,并将表格数据保存在第一个sheet中。这样,我们就可以成功地将表格数据导入到Mathematica中进行处理。
以上介绍了Mathematica文本数据导入导出的一些经验与技巧。希望对您有所帮助!